محمدآبادی 65 ارسال شده در آبان 91 گزارش بازنشر ارسال شده در آبان 91 سلاممن نياز به يك كد يا افزونه يا هر روش ديگه دارم كه اعضايي كه سطح مشترك دارن، نتونن وارد سايت بشنسايت روي خط وردپرس، اين كد رو داده كه اگه توي فانكشن گذاشته بشه، فقط اعضا ميتونن وارد سايت بشنfunction protect_whole_site() { if ( !is_user_logged_in() ) { auth_redirect(); }}add_action ('template_redirect', 'protect_whole_site');ولي من به كدي نياز دارم كه فقط، كاربران «مدير، ويرايشگر، نويسنده و مشاركتكننده» بتونن وارد بشنچون يك عالمه مشترك دارم كه ميخوام دسترسي به سايت نداشته باشنآيا همچنين كاري ممكنه؟! پيشاپيش سپاسگذارم نقل قول لینک به ارسال
Morteza 34190 ارسال شده در آبان 91 گزارش بازنشر ارسال شده در آبان 91 این رو تست کنید:function protect_whole_site() { if ( !is_user_logged_in() || !current_user_can('delete_posts') ) { auth_redirect(); }}add_action ('template_redirect', 'protect_whole_site'); 3 نقل قول لینک به ارسال
محمدآبادی 65 ارسال شده در آبان 91 مالک گزارش بازنشر ارسال شده در آبان 91 دستت درد نكنه آقا مرتضيدقيقا همون چيزي بود كه ميخواستم، خدا خوشحالت كنهقيمت سرور مجازي خيلي بالا رفته ، ميخوام كاربراي سايت رو محدود كنم تا بتونم باز برگردم سر همون هاست اشتراكي موفقيت نقل قول لینک به ارسال
mpc 0 ارسال شده در آبان 91 گزارش بازنشر ارسال شده در آبان 91 این رو تست کنید:function protect_whole_site() { if ( !is_user_logged_in() || !current_user_can('delete_posts') ) { auth_redirect(); }}add_action ('template_redirect', 'protect_whole_site');من یه کدی می خام که جلوگیری کنه از ورود کاربران مشترک به بخش آپلود سایت, چون همان طور که می دونید وقتی یه کاربر جدید در سایت عضو می شه وقتی لوگین می کنه می تونه از طریق کتابخانه فایل آپلود کنه می خواستم جلوی اینو ببندم. نقل قول لینک به ارسال
Parsa 23463 ارسال شده در آبان 91 گزارش بازنشر ارسال شده در آبان 91 من یه کدی می خام که جلوگیری کنه از ورود کاربران مشترک به بخش آپلود سایت, چون همان طور که می دونید وقتی یه کاربر جدید در سایت عضو می شه وقتی لوگین می کنه می تونه از طریق کتابخانه فایل آپلود کنه می خواستم جلوی اینو ببندم.با افزونه Advanced Access Manager دسترسی را تنظیم کنید 4 نقل قول لینک به ارسال
Morteza 34190 ارسال شده در آبان 91 گزارش بازنشر ارسال شده در آبان 91 + همچنین:برای نویسنده:function remove_medialibrary_tab($tabs) { unset($tabs['library']); return $tabs;}if(!current_user_can('edit_others_posts')) add_filter('media_upload_tabs','remove_medialibrary_tab');برای مشترک:function remove_medialibrary_tab($tabs) { unset($tabs['library']); return $tabs;}if(!current_user_can('read')) add_filter('media_upload_tabs','remove_medialibrary_tab'); 3 نقل قول لینک به ارسال
پست های پیشنهاد شده
به گفتگو بپیوندید
هم اکنون می توانید مطلب خود را ارسال نمایید و بعداً ثبت نام کنید. اگر حساب کاربری دارید، برای ارسال با حساب کاربری خود اکنون وارد شوید .